a group consisting of five musicians or singers who perform together
A quintet is a musical ensemble consisting of five singers or musicians who collaborate to perform a piece of music. This formation allows for rich, layered harmonies and complex arrangements, with each performer contributing a unique part. Quintets can cover various musical genres and showcase the individual skills of each member while blending their sounds into a cohesive and dynamic performance.
